Dalkey Park
15 sales have been filed on the Property Price Register for Dalkey Park since 2011, at a median of €875,000.
They ran from €509,500 to €1,015,000. None of them was a new build.

Why this street and not others
A street gets a page once at least 5 sales have been recorded on it. Below that a median is a handful of anecdotes rather than a figure, and a page saying so would be worse than no page.
Source: Property Services Regulatory Authority, used under the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 licence. Sales that were not at arm’s length are excluded throughout.
